Output 2b6a83f05e94ffedd24dcce95472ef56e919d5c0df044981090323fac1f3caaa:2

value
1502500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d9333c5562a2e963b9dc38fcb447dff81a14fc OP_EQUAL
address
3DtjzPRe7hXYxZYcJRRjbMN7G7GYRVCsnG
transaction
2b6a83f05e94ffedd24dcce95472ef56e919d5c0df044981090323fac1f3caaa
confirmations
155398
spent
true